About The Role

The Marketing Coordinator supports the execution of direct mail and digital revenue generation. Reporting to the Director, Integrated Marketing, this position assists in the execution of direct response revenue generating strategies (including direct mail and email marketing efforts). The incumbent will also provide administrative support to the Director, Integrated Marketing and will regularly collaborate with their colleagues on the Marketing team.

About us

The Ottawa Hospital is one of Canada’s top learning and research hospitals, where excellent care is inspired by research and driven by compassion. Our multi-campus hospital, affiliated with the University of Ottawa, attracts some of the most influential scientific minds from around the world. Our focus on learning and research leads to new techniques and discoveries that are adopted globally to improve patient care.

The Foundation’s (TOHF) purpose is to inspire and enable support for the highest quality healthcare and world-class research at The Ottawa Hospital. Backed by generous support from the community, we are committed to providing the world-class, compassionate care we would want for our loved ones.

In this position, you will:

  • Work closely with our incumbent agency to support the execution of our direct mail strategies. This includes project management, content approvals, data requests, as well as reporting back on appeal performance.
  • Build critical paths in project management software (Wrike) to ensure all elements of integration are captured.
  • Provide administrative support to the Director, Integrated Marketing, including calendar management and scheduling, general meeting support (i.e. preparing meeting agendas, recording meeting minutes, tracking meeting action items etc.)
  • Collaborate with the marketing team to ensure proper execution of e-communication.
  • Support the deployment of email communication to donors and stakeholders (using pre-determined segments and content).
  • Other administrative duties as required (processing invoices, coordinating signatures, budget tracking etc.)
